A specialist SEN school in Preston seeks an experienced Outdoor Education Specialist to join their team. The successful candidate will develop and deliver engaging outdoor learning programs for students with diverse special educational needs.

Key Responsibilities

  • Plan and deliver adapted outdoor education sessions for SEN students
  • Conduct thorough risk assessments for all activities
  • Create progressive outdoor curriculum building confidence and skills
  • Support students to access challenging activities through differentiation
  • Maintain outdoor learning equipment and spaces
  • Collaborate with classroom teachers to connect outdoor and indoor learning

Requirements

  • Outdoor education qualification or substantial experience
  • Experience working with SEN students
  • Valid First Aid certification
  • Excellent risk assessment and management skills
  • DBS check required

£90-£110 per day depending on experience and qualifications.
